From 1e239289d5fe8a95fd7dc3bb7327704222f27227 Mon Sep 17 00:00:00 2001 From: Hongguang Chen Date: Wed, 22 Apr 2020 14:25:45 -0700 Subject: [PATCH] fastbootd: Support TCP protocol. The current fastbootd only supports USB protocol. But some Android TV devices are built without USB port. The fastbootd cannot be used on those ATV devices due to it. This change adds TCP protocol for such devices and fastbootd.protocol property is added to control which protocol to use. BUG: 152544169 Test: manual test.
